Description

Make quick, easy homemade applesauce on your stovetop. You control the texture, choosing chunky or smooth, and you can skip the added sugar for a healthier treat. This recipe honors simple, fresh ingredients for a flavor better than store-bought.


Ingredients

Scale
  • 6 large apples (like Granny Smith or Honeycrisp), peeled, cored, and chopped
  • 1/2 cup water or apple cider
  • 1 teaspoon ground cinnamon (optional)
  • 1 tablespoon lemon juice (optional)


Instructions

  1. Place the chopped apples and water (or cider) into a large saucepan.
  2. Bring the mixture to a boil over medium-high heat.
  3. Reduce heat to low, cover the pot, and simmer for 15 to 20 minutes. Stir occasionally to prevent sticking.
  4. Cook until the apples are very tender and easily mashable.
  5. If using, stir in the cinnamon and lemon juice.
  6. For smooth applesauce, mash the mixture with a potato masher or use an immersion blender until you reach your desired consistency. For chunky, simply mash lightly.
  7. Remove from heat and let it cool slightly before serving or storing.

Notes

  • Use a mix of sweet and tart apples for the best flavor balance.
  • If you prefer sweeter applesauce, add 1 to 2 tablespoons of maple syrup or brown sugar during the last 5 minutes of cooking.
  • The lemon juice brightens the flavor and helps prevent browning if you plan on storing it.
  • This applesauce stores well in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to one week.
